Briefly describe a mixed economy

Answer:

A mixed economic system is a system that combines aspects of both capitalism and socialism. A mixed economic system protects private property and allows a level of economic freedom in the use of capital, but also allows for governments to interfere in economic activities in order to achieve social aims.

What are 2 specific properties of an ellipse?
Umnica [9.8K]

Answer:

All ellipses have two focal points, or foci. The sum of the distances from every point on the ellipse to the two foci is a constant. All ellipses have a center and a major and minor axis. All ellipses have eccentricity values greater than or equal to zero, and less than one.
